
Excel转mdb数据库的步骤及源代码解析

要将Excel文件转换成MDB数据库,首先需要明确MDB数据库是Microsoft Access用来存储数据的文件格式。转换过程涉及多种方法,包括使用编程语言编写代码,利用现有的数据库管理系统,或者使用一些自动化工具。本知识点详细说明了如何使用Visual Basic for Applications (VBA) 编程语言在Excel环境下进行转换操作。
首先,我们需要了解在VBA中打开和操作Excel文件的基本方法。VBA是Excel内置的编程语言,可以用来编写宏和自动化任务。通过VBA,我们能够读取Excel文件中的数据,并将这些数据导入到Access数据库中。
转换过程大致可以分为以下几个步骤:
1. 准备Excel文件:确保你的Excel文件中的数据是组织好的,最好是每张工作表上数据列对应数据库中的字段名。此外,应检查并清除可能影响数据导入的特殊格式或者合并单元格等问题。
2. 打开VBA编辑器:在Excel中按下`Alt + F11`组合键打开VBA编辑器。
3. 编写VBA代码:在VBA编辑器中,我们可以编写代码来打开Excel文件,读取数据,然后创建一个MDB文件,并在该文件中创建数据表和字段,并将数据导入到Access数据库。
4. 运行代码:编写完代码后,可以运行宏来执行转换操作。如果代码编写正确,Excel中的数据将会被导入到新创建的MDB文件中。
针对提供的文件名称列表,我们可以进一步分析可能涉及的文件类型:
- Form1.frm: 这可能是VBA工程中的一个表单,用于提供用户界面,以便用户可以通过点击按钮等控件来执行数据转换操作。
- XlsToMdb.mdb: 这个文件名暗示它可能是包含用于执行转换过程代码的Access数据库文件。
- Project1.vbp: 这是一个Visual Basic项目文件,包含了该VBA项目的设置和引用信息。在其中可以配置项目所使用的库和模块,以及对应的窗口和控件等。
- XlsToMdb.xls: 这是一个Excel文件,极有可能就是包含数据的源文件,我们将从这个文件读取数据,然后进行转换导入到MDB数据库。
考虑到这些文件类型和任务描述,我们大致可以推测,转换过程可能使用VBA代码来读取XlsToMdb.xls中的数据,通过Project1.vbp项目进行管理,最终数据被导入到XlsToMdb.mdb数据库文件中,而Form1.frm可能是执行这个过程的用户界面。
在实际应用中,这个转换过程可能涉及到一些技术挑战,如数据类型转换(例如从Excel的日期格式转换为Access能够识别的日期格式),处理大量数据的导入(可能需要分批导入以避免性能问题),以及错误处理(比如处理重复的数据或者数据丢失问题)。
总的来说,把Excel文件转换成MDB数据库是一个涉及到文件处理、数据操作和数据库管理的综合任务,对于掌握VBA编程的IT专业人士来说,这是一个常见的数据迁移和数据处理需求。通过本知识点的讲解,读者应该能够对如何使用VBA进行这种类型的数据转换有了基本的了解,并且知道如何根据实际情况进行适当的调整。
相关推荐





求伯乐
- 粉丝: 22
最新资源
- 离线使用:USACO全套测试数据整理
- 复变函数与积分变换电子教案详解
- ComicEnhancerPro_chn:用ILIAD阅读PDF图片的修正神器
- Flex与Java结合实现上传功能的实用示例
- 掌握DDE技术在Access数据库管理中的应用
- PHPWind与DVBBS论坛整合工具2.0发布
- C#编程:自定义常用函数实现高效算法
- Windows7程序设计开发全攻略
- 西电高西全《数字信号处理》第三版课件解析
- L298驱动芯片与L297双击驱动中文应用指南
- Oracle数据库11g管理I考试指南(第三部分)
- Java实现图书管理系统界面设计与开发
- ASP.NET+C#构建的综合办公系统源代码解析
- SSH2+Ext框架示例:用户注册与登录代码演示
- BQ24030与BQ24070充电管理IC设计资料解析
- Oracle经典教材:初学者的宝贵资源
- 掌握DirectX 9三维图形编程的深度技术
- 《矢量图形系统开发与编程》第二版全面解析
- JQUERY+APACHE实现带进度条的上传功能
- VC++开发的单频信号发生程序,跨平台使用体验
- 下载最新dota6.61作弊地图
- 深入解析C语言编程:第三版详解
- asp+access网上书店系统完整学习教程
- FPGA开发基础与技巧全攻略详解